Bull Shoals Woman Arrested on Drug Charges in Mountain Home

Summary by Ozark Radio News
A Bull Shoals woman was booked into the Baxter County Jail early Tuesday on multiple felony drug charges. Mountain Home Police arrested 57‑year‑old Debra May Rios just after 12:30 a.m. on May 5. According to jail records, she is charged with possession of methamphetamine or cocaine with purpose to deliver, possession of a Schedule I or II controlled substance under two grams, and possession of a Schedule IV or V substance under 28 grams, a Class…
